President Masoud Barzani Meets Assyrians for Justice Leader in Iraq

President Masoud Barzani welcomed the head of the Assyrians for Justice Foundation in Pirmam on Sunday. The meeting highlighted growing engagement between Kurdish leadership and Assyrian advocates. Moreover, both sides focused on strengthening coexistence across the Kurdistan Region. Barzani reaffirmed his commitment to protecting religious and ethnic diversity. He stressed that pluralism strengthens stability and unity.He also highlighted the historical relationship between Kurds and Assyrians.

Furthermore, he described mutual respect as a pillar of regional peace. Meanwhile, the Assyrian delegation discussed long-standing justice concerns. They emphasized historical recognition and cultural rights. Additionally, they praised the Kurdistan Region for supporting minority communities. They described the region as a safe haven during periods of conflict.

Moreover, discussions addressed challenges facing Assyrian communities today. Participants examined displacement issues and property ownership disputes. They also stressed protecting heritage sites and religious landmarks. In addition, they discussed education as a tool for cultural survival.

Consequently, Barzani encouraged continued dialogue and cooperation. He supported peaceful advocacy through legal and political frameworks. He also emphasized collaboration with international partners. However, both sides acknowledged ongoing regional instability. They agreed unity offers the strongest response to extremism.

Therefore, they committed to sustained communication and future meetings. Ultimately, the meeting reinforced Kurdistan’s message of inclusion. Leaders and advocates expressed optimism about deeper cooperation ahead.
